PSL University (Paris Sciences & Lettres)

Mines Paris – PSL, in partnership with other institutions of excellence, created Université PSL in 2010. Thirteen years later, PSL is recognized as a world-class research university, as demonstrated by its excellent international rankings. This recognition enhances the value of our degrees and opens up new opportunities for international mobility. For you, the students of our schools, PSL will have a tangible impact from the moment you join. We’re working together to offer you career paths that meet your expectations, while promoting internal mobility at PSL. Each year, several weeks of teaching are open to mobility, enabling you to discover new disciplines in our schools and in other PSL establishments, such as the École Nationale Supérieure d’Architecture Paris – Malaquais or Université Paris Dauphine. Numerous double degrees are available between PSL establishments, with new collaborations developing every year. PSL also boasts a dynamic student life in Paris, in the heart of the Latin Quarter. Every year, the Student Union expands, offering shared services dedicated to sports, languages, housing, health and safety, and entrepreneurship. Get ready for an experience rich in discovery!

Housing

At the Maison des Mines et des Ponts

At Mines Paris – PSL, all first-year engineering students can benefit from a double room at the Maison des Mines et des Ponts (commonly known as “La Meuh”), located at 270 rue Saint-Jacques, Paris 5th arrondissement. This opportunity fosters strong cohesion within the class and encourages active participation in student life.

Information and contact

An e-mail detailing accommodation arrangements will be sent to you at the end of July by Aria Chafai (aria.chafai@etu.minesparis.psl.eu). If you have any further questions, please contact the room managers (“piauleurs”) at piauleurs@minesparis.psl.eu.

Room availability

Although every first-year student is entitled to a room, it’s important not to apply for a place if you don’t need one, so as to leave places available for second- and third-year students.

Application form

The Maison des Mines application form, specifying accommodation requirements, must be sent by post before August 12, 2024 to the following address:

Maison des Mines et des Ponts et Chaussées 270 Rue Saint-Jacques, 75005 Paris, France

Registration

Payment of tuition fees for 2024-2025

Tuition fees must be paid to the Accounting Agent of the École nationale supérieure des Mines de Paris (ENSMP), according to the electronically transmitted registration fees.

Exemptions for scholarship students

Students on a scholarship from Mines Paris – PSL, the Fondation Mines Paris, Campus France (BGF, Eiffel), a foreign government, other foundations, or on an international double degree are not required to pay tuition fees.

Scholarship holders from Campus France (BGF, Eiffel), foreign governments, other foundations or organizations are required to provide supporting documents. This must be uploaded to OASIS, under the “Administrative” tab.

Payment methods

Tuition fees can be paid in one of two ways:

  1. By credit card: Once your School address has been activated, you can make your payment at the following address: paiement.minesparis.psl.eu
  2. By bank transfer: The bank details of the Accounting Officer will be sent to you electronically.

If you have any questions or require further assistance, please do not hesitate to contact the ENSMP administration.

Payment of CVEC

The CVEC (Contribution Vie Étudiante et de Campus) is a compulsory contribution of €103.00 for all students. To pay it, please visit the CROUS website before the start of the academic year (see note on CVEC):

CVEC

Once payment has been made, download your certificate of payment (or exemption) from OASIS, in the “Attachments” tab. Don’t forget to enter your CVEC certificate number in the “General” tab, in the “CVEC certificate no.” field.

To attend the first class of the year, make sure your registration fees and CVEC are paid before the start of the school year on September 2, 2024.

Proof of social security coverage

You must be able to present your social security certificate on request. To do this, make sure you have taken the necessary steps to ensure that your social security cover is in order for the year 2024-2025.

Scholarship application

  • Parents declaring income in France: complete the application form before September 6, 2024 via this link.
  • Parents not declaring income in France: apply for a scholarship before September 6, 2024 via this link.

Scholarship students are exempt from tuition fees. The scholarship committee will meet in mid-September to validate all exemptions. If you have any questions, please contact odile.malezieux@minesparis.psl.eu.

Steps to take and documents to prepare

Social security

Check your affiliation to a French social security scheme at www.ameli.fr. For first-time international students, visit this site.

Compulsory insurance

  • Civil liability and personal accident insurance (or school and extra-curricular insurance).
  • Mutuelle (optional): recommended for those who do not benefit from their parents’ mutuelle.
  • Health insurance abroad: strongly recommended for internships abroad.

Medical certificate

As sport is compulsory in the first year, you must provide a medical certificate stating that you are fit for sport, or an exemption in the event of inaptitude.
